pH 1.679 Certified Reference Material CRM Buffer Standard Solution, IUPAC, 500 mL. Certified Reference Material CRM according to EN ISO 17034. Certified Reference Material CRM pH Buffer IUPAC Standard Solution according DIN EN ISO 17034:2017 (D-RM-15184-01-00) with Certificate of Analysis* reporting exact pH buffer value.

Hach Lange GmbH is accredited by the German accreditation authority DAkkS as registered reference material producer according to DIN EN ISO 17034:2017. Compared to ISO 17025, ISO 17034 has an additional requirement for reliable and traceable manufacturing of products.
The use of standards manufactured by an accredited reference material producer provides complete confidence in the traceability chain and calculated uncertainties. All standards are formulated in compliance with NIST and IUPAC specifications.
Each standard is delivered in an airtight aluminum bag package ensuring safe storage.
Until first opening the certified value is guaranteed for 2 years from the date of issue of the certificate.
Each standard has its own Certificate of Analysis available for download from Hach website.
Each standard has its own Certificate of Conformity and Traceability available for download from Hach web site. The use of standards pH Buffers manufactured by an accredited laboratory gives you complete confidence in the traceability chain and calculated uncertainties.
Technical Attributes
- Color coded: No
- Description: pH Buffer Calibration reagent
- NIST Traceable: Yes
- Package Type: Bottle
- Parameter: pH
- pH Value(s): 1.679 ±0.010 pH at 25°C
- Quantity: 500 mL
- Storage Conditions: 10 - 25 °C (protect from light)
